Jnanpith award winner O.N.V. Kurup dead


Thiruvananthapuram, Feb 13 (IANS): Jnanpith Award winner and renowned Malayali poet and lyricist O.N.V. Kurup died at a hospital here on Saturday, his family said. He was 84.

Popularly known as O.N.V., he was suffering from age-related illness.
